Cape Le Grand National Park, Lucky Bay. Had a fun windsurf there in the 90's just before the sinking of the Sanko Harvest. Ended working the oil spill clean up for next few months.
Remember some frantic water starts on days off around Esperance and later Cactus on my way back east.
There was a reef break somewhere around there, near a pub, monster paddle and felt sharky.
